class JsonResponseHeader(ApiParam):
|
||||
"""SGP.22 section 6.5.1.4."""
|
||||
@classmethod
|
||||
def verify_decoded(cls, data):
|
||||
fe_status = data.get('functionExecutionStatus')
|
||||
if not fe_status:
|
||||
raise ValueError('Missing mandatory functionExecutionStatus in header')
|
||||
status = fe_status.get('status')
|
||||
if not status:
|
||||
raise ValueError('Missing mandatory status in header functionExecutionStatus')
|
||||
if status not in ['Executed-Success', 'Executed-WithWarning', 'Failed', 'Expired']:
|
||||
raise ValueError('Unknown/unspecified status "%s"' % status)

# ES2+ DownloadOrder function (SGP.22 section 5.3.1)
|
||||
class DownloadOrder(Es2PlusApiFunction):
|
||||
path = '/gsma/rsp2/es2plus/downloadOrder'
|
||||
input_params = {
|
||||
'eid': param.Eid,
|
||||
'iccid': param.Iccid,
|
||||
'profileType': param.ProfileType
|
||||
}
|
||||
output_params = {
|
||||
'header': param.JsonResponseHeader,
|
||||
'iccid': param.Iccid,
|
||||
}
|
||||
output_mandatory = ['header', 'iccid']
|
||||
|
||||
# ES2+ ConfirmOrder function (SGP.22 section 5.3.2)
|
||||
class ConfirmOrder(Es2PlusApiFunction):
|
||||
path = '/gsma/rsp2/es2plus/confirmOrder'
|
||||
input_params = {
|
||||
'iccid': param.Iccid,
|
||||
'eid': param.Eid,
|
||||
'matchingId': param.MatchingId,
|
||||
'confirmationCode': param.ConfirmationCode,
|
||||
'smdsAddress': param.SmdsAddress,
|
||||
'releaseFlag': param.ReleaseFlag,
|
||||
}
|
||||
input_mandatory = ['iccid', 'releaseFlag']
|
||||
output_params = {
|
||||
'header': param.JsonResponseHeader,
|
||||
'eid': param.Eid,
|
||||
'matchingId': param.MatchingId,
|
||||
'smdpAddress': param.SmdpAddress,
|
||||
}
|
||||
output_mandatory = ['header', 'matchingId']
|
||||
|
||||
# ES2+ CancelOrder function (SGP.22 section 5.3.3)
|
||||
class CancelOrder(Es2PlusApiFunction):
|
||||
path = '/gsma/rsp2/es2plus/cancelOrder'
|
||||
input_params = {
|
||||
'iccid': param.Iccid,
|
||||
'eid': param.Eid,
|
||||
'matchingId': param.MatchingId,
|
||||
'finalProfileStatusIndicator': param.FinalProfileStatusIndicator,
|
||||
}
|
||||
input_mandatory = ['finalProfileStatusIndicator', 'iccid']
|
||||
output_params = {
|
||||
'header': param.JsonResponseHeader,
|
||||
}
|
||||
output_mandatory = ['header']
|
||||
|
||||
# ES2+ ReleaseProfile function (SGP.22 section 5.3.4)
|
||||
class ReleaseProfile(Es2PlusApiFunction):
|
||||
path = '/gsma/rsp2/es2plus/releaseProfile'
|
||||
input_params = {
|
||||
'iccid': param.Iccid,
|
||||
}
|
||||
input_mandatory = ['iccid']
|
||||
output_params = {
|
||||
'header': param.JsonResponseHeader,
|
||||
}
|
||||
output_mandatory = ['header']
|
||||
|
||||
# ES2+ HandleDownloadProgress function (SGP.22 section 5.3.5)
|
||||
class HandleDownloadProgressInfo(Es2PlusApiFunction):
|
||||
path = '/gsma/rsp2/es2plus/handleDownloadProgressInfo'
|
||||
input_params = {
|
||||
'eid': param.Eid,
|
||||
'iccid': param.Iccid,
|
||||
'profileType': param.ProfileType,
|
||||
'timestamp': param.Timestamp,
|
||||
'notificationPointId': param.NotificationPointId,
|
||||
'notificationPointStatus': param.NotificationPointStatus,
|
||||
'resultData': param.ResultData,
|
||||
}
|
||||
input_mandatory = ['iccid', 'profileType', 'timestamp', 'notificationPointId', 'notificationPointStatus']
|
||||
expected_http_status = 204

class Es2pApiClient:
|
||||
"""Main class representing a full ES2+ API client. Has one method for each API function."""
|
||||
def __init__(self, url_prefix:str, func_req_id:str, server_cert_verify: str = None, client_cert: str = None):
|
||||
self.func_id = 0
|
||||
self.session = requests.Session()
|
||||
if server_cert_verify:
|
||||
self.session.verify = server_cert_verify
|
||||
if client_cert:
|
||||
self.session.cert = client_cert
|
||||
|
||||
self.downloadOrder = DownloadOrder(url_prefix, func_req_id, self.session)
|
||||
self.confirmOrder = ConfirmOrder(url_prefix, func_req_id, self.session)
|
||||
self.cancelOrder = CancelOrder(url_prefix, func_req_id, self.session)
|
||||
self.releaseProfile = ReleaseProfile(url_prefix, func_req_id, self.session)
|
||||
self.handleDownloadProgressInfo = HandleDownloadProgressInfo(url_prefix, func_req_id, self.session)
|
||||
|
||||
def _gen_func_id(self) -> str:
|
||||
"""Generate the next function call id."""
|
||||
self.func_id += 1
|
||||
return 'FCI-%u-%u' % (time.time(), self.func_id)
|
||||
|
||||
|
||||
def call_downloadOrder(self, data: dict) -> dict:
|
||||
"""Perform ES2+ DownloadOrder function (SGP.22 section 5.3.1)."""
|
||||
return self.downloadOrder.call(data, self._gen_func_id())
|
||||
|
||||
def call_confirmOrder(self, data: dict) -> dict:
|
||||
"""Perform ES2+ ConfirmOrder function (SGP.22 section 5.3.2)."""
|
||||
return self.confirmOrder.call(data, self._gen_func_id())
|
||||
|
||||
def call_cancelOrder(self, data: dict) -> dict:
|
||||
"""Perform ES2+ CancelOrder function (SGP.22 section 5.3.3)."""
|
||||
return self.cancelOrder.call(data, self._gen_func_id())
|
||||
|
||||
def call_releaseProfile(self, data: dict) -> dict:
|
||||
"""Perform ES2+ CancelOrder function (SGP.22 section 5.3.4)."""
|
||||
return self.releaseProfile.call(data, self._gen_func_id())
|
||||
|
||||
def call_handleDownloadProgressInfo(self, data: dict) -> dict:
|
||||
"""Perform ES2+ HandleDownloadProgressInfo function (SGP.22 section 5.3.5)."""
|
||||
return self.handleDownloadProgressInfo.call(data, self._gen_func_id())
